Who is a Confidence Man?

A confidence man is a person who gains the trust and confidence of others in order to exploit them for financial gain or other advantages. These individuals are adept at using psychological techniques to manipulate their victims into believing their fabricated stories and false promises.

Characteristics of a Confidence Man

  • Charm: One of the key characteristics of a confidence man is their charm and charisma. They are able to quickly establish rapport with their targets, making it easier to deceive them.
  • Manipulation: Confidence men are skilled manipulators who know how to play on the emotions and vulnerabilities of their victims to achieve their goals.
  • Deception: These individuals are masterful liars who can spin elaborate tales and create scenarios that seem believable to the unsuspecting victim.
  • Adaptability: A confidence man is adaptable and can change tactics on the fly to suit the situation and the personality of their target.

Common Confidence Tricks

There are many different types of confidence tricks employed by con artists to deceive their victims. Some of the most common schemes include:

  1. Phishing Scams: Confidence men often use emails or messages posing as legitimate organizations to obtain sensitive information such as passwords and bank account details.
  2. Ponzi Schemes: In a Ponzi scheme, the con artist lures investors by promising high returns but instead uses the money from new investors to pay off earlier investors.
  3. Psychic Readings: Some confidence men pose as psychics or mediums, claiming to have special powers and offering to provide guidance for a fee.

What is a confidence man and how is it different from a con artist or scammer?

A confidence man, often referred to as a con man, is a person who deceives others by gaining their trust and confidence in order to exploit them financially or otherwise. While a con artist or scammer may use various tactics to deceive their victims, a confidence man typically relies on building a relationship with the victim to manipulate them into giving up their money or valuables willingly.

What are some common characteristics or traits of a confidence man?

Confidence men often possess charisma, charm, and the ability to manipulate others through persuasive communication. They may also exhibit a sense of authority or credibility that helps them gain the trust of their victims. Additionally, confidence men are skilled at identifying and exploiting the vulnerabilities or desires of their targets to achieve their deceptive goals.

How do confidence men establish trust with their victims?

Confidence men use various tactics to establish trust with their victims, such as creating a false sense of familiarity, offering false promises or guarantees, and presenting themselves as trustworthy individuals. They may also use social proof or references from supposed satisfied customers to further validate their credibility. By appearing genuine and reliable, confidence men are able to gain the confidence of their targets.

What are some common scams or schemes employed by confidence men?

Confidence men may engage in a wide range of scams and schemes to defraud their victims, including investment fraud, romance scams, identity theft, and Ponzi schemes. They may also use techniques such as phishing emails, fake websites, or phone calls to deceive individuals into providing personal information or financial resources. These scams often prey on the victims emotions or desires to manipulate them into falling for the deception.
